A Survey of Apps for E-Learning 2015
Journal Title: International Journal of the Computer, the Internet and Management - Year 2015, Vol 23, Issue 3
Abstract
As of year 2015, the total number of Apps available in leading Apps Stores including Google Play, Apple App Store, Window Phone Store, Amazon App Store, and Blackberry were about 3.97 million apps. The number of users of apps is increasing every day. As an example, the number of users of Google Apps for Education, including e-education or eLearning, would reach 110,000,000 users by the year 2020. This paper will discuss iSpring's mobile apps for eLearning, eLearning app to prepare for driving exam test, eLearning app to prepare for college entrance exams, and top ten tools and apps to boost eLearning productivity.
